How we calculated this

We compared this property's assessed value per square foot ($418/sqft) against the median for the neighborhood ($312/sqft). This property is assessed 34.1% higher than typical homes nearby.

If the appraisal district adjusted the value to the neighborhood median, the owner could save approximately $5,651 per year in property taxes based on the Hays County effective tax rate.

In this neighborhood, 100% of protests resulted in a reduction, with a median reduction of $76,470.
